What it does on your line
The B0109GM-200C is a maximum-format 50-slot ESD magazine rack rated to 200 °C (392 °F), built for in-line SMT automation plus moisture-sensitive device (MSD) baking on the widest board lines, backplanes, motherboards, oversized industrial PCBs. Same chassis and gear-track mechanism as the B0109GN-80C, the difference is the higher-temperature material qualification, which makes the rack bake-suitable per IPC/JEDEC J-STD-033 moisture-removal profiles (typically 90–125 °C for 24–72 hours).
Construction: 5 interchangeable Conductive PPE side panels per wall, aluminum pillars, galvanized steel base. Same conductive 10⁴–10⁶ Ω surface band per ESD Association classification, same NASTC test report. The bake-suitable PPE qualification adds headroom for J-STD-033 accelerated bake (125 °C) and conformal-coat post-cure (typically 150–200 °C) without panel softening or off-gassing.
Gear-track adjustment sets board width from 50 to 460 mm with parallelism maintained across all 50 slots, widest gear range in the catalog. For aerospace-grade cure cycles above 200 °C, use the B0109GL HT-300C all-aluminum sibling on the same maximum chassis (300 °C ceiling, swaps PPE for aluminum panels).
